The Scottish Government makes means-tested childcare funds are available for students using registered childcare in the academic year … Web25 jun. 2024 · Tax-Free Childcare (TFC) You can get up to £500 every three months for each of your children to help with the costs of childcare – or £1,000 if your child has a disability. If you get TFC, the Government will pay £2 for every £8 you pay your childcare provider via an online account.
